Comprehensive Laboratory Analysis of Sunflower Oil
A thorough scientific examination of sunflower petroleum involves a series of evaluations to verify its standard. This encompasses assessing tangible properties such as shade, presentation, specific gravity, refraction , and thickness . Furthermore , chemical evaluation is critical , involving measurements of acidity , oxidation level, iodine index, alkali requirement, and unsaponifiable matter . Fatty acid profiling, typically using gas chromatography, provides information on the structure of oils, like oleic acid , linoleic acid , and palmitic acid . Finally , tests for spoilage and the existence of foreign matter are executed to ensure consumer safety and product integrity .

Sunflower Oil Quality Report: Key Findings & Standards
Our recent review of sunflower's oil standard reveals significant insights regarding its properties . Strict criteria, established by organizations like the European Union , dictate acceptable levels of fatty acids , Sunflower Oil Wholesale Supplier water content , hue , and peroxide value . Specifically , free fatty acid content should be below 0.2% , while iodine index generally is between 125 and 135 .
- Acceptable oil should exhibit minimal fragrance and sensation.
- Purified sunflower oil typically undergoes bleaching to improve its aesthetic presentation.
- Analysis methods include gas chromatography and titration to ensure compliance with the designated requirements.
Decoding Your Vegetable Oil Analysis Results
So, you've received your vegetable oil test data – now what? Decoding these readings can seem daunting, but it's relatively straightforward than you believe. Generally, the report will list key characteristics like free fatty acids, PV, and color. A low FFA indicates prime quality, while a high PV might signal rancidity. Ultimately, a qualified laboratory technician can most interpret the detailed implications for your unique situation.
